Position Summary:

The Achieves Assistant will contribute to the preservation and accessibility of historical materials related to Maharishi and the university. By scanning archival documents of high quality and integrating them into the SOMA (Searchable Online Maharishi Archive) software system this role significantly accelerates efforts to digitize and organize the complete body of Maharishis teachings on SOMA benefiting students faculty TM teachers and the public by providing easy access to this valuable knowledge.

Students this Position Appeals to:

This position is ideal for students in any degree program who are inspired to contribute to MIUs preservation of knowledge aligning with the universitys mission of fostering holistic education and those who are interested in research and history of MIU archival work digital preservation or related fields.

Experience Gained / Advantages for Student:

  • Hands-on experience in archival sorting and procedures of preservation digitization and documentation methods while gaining an understanding of Vedic literature.
  • Enhancement of organizational skills in the workplace as well as computer skills including proficiency in Adobe Pro and other archival software.
  • Expand the accessibility of valuable historical resources regarding Maharishi the history of the TM Org and MIU.



Job Responsibilities:

  1. Scan archival documents with precision and care to ensure high-quality digital reproduction.
  2. Upload documents to the SOMA software and input important publishing information.
  3. Assess and categorize documents and transcripts.
  4. Organize the archival collections that are presently held by MIU archives to preserve them according to standard archival procedures.
  5. Assist in publishing reference materials for student and faculty research.


Job Qualifications:

  • Trustworthy and diligent in handling secure documents with awareness of security and responsibility of keeping materials safe.
  • Strong work ethic with attention to detail and organizational skills.
  • Desire to learn about archival practices.
  • Proficient in computer skills including Adobe Pro with a quick ability to learn new applications such as SOMA software.
